Licensing Board and Data Source: Texas Physician Assistant Board and the Texas Medical Board (TMB) - The Texas Physician Assistant Board adopts rules for the licensing of persons wishing to practice as Physician Assistants in Texas. These rules must be approved or rejected by a vote of the TMB. TMB staff provides licensing data for Physician Assistants practicing in Texas.

Note: Many agencies that certify or license health professionals collect only a licensee's mailing address for correspondence purposes. The mailing (RESIDENCE) address may be either the work or home address of the licensee. If available, the HPRC county totals for each profession are based on the PRACTICE address from licensure data, and from the mailing/residence address if the practice address is not available. Therefore, when the mailing/residence address is used, the county supply totals may not accurately reflect the actual supply in a county since a professional may live in one county but practice in another.
